I don't know a lot about the plaster but have a friend who did a finish on walls in his previous house. I know his wife put something on it to preserve the finish but the first thing he said to me was that he would never do that again (the finish and whatever he put on the walls). He said that who ever bought their home, if they wanted to cover the finish they would have to sand it down because of whatever they put on there would make it impossible to just paint over. Like PP said, I would talk with someone with more know-how.

As for the wall sconce shade, are you asking about something like this:

world-imports-wall-sconce.jpg


I would try someplace like Lowe's or Home Depot first, if not find a good lighting shop. Kids broke a sconce cover and I could never find one to fit. I took the sconce in and we found the correct size and the lady there helped me go through the books to find what I needed, ordered it and got it a few weeks later. It might be easier if you have two, just buy two new ones.
